Definitions and Meaning of paraplegic in English

Wordnet

paraplegic (n)

a person who has paraplegia (is paralyzed from the waist down)

Wordnet

paraplegic (s)

suffering complete paralysis of the lower half of the body usually resulting from damage to the spinal cord
